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
032521 21 33355 7417900151 0338377
8784523 5900829
8784523 5900829
0432 83678 9483286 5656665536 500
All about undefined
Interested in learning more?
8784523 5900829
0432 83678 9483286 5656665536 500
See more
0646018365 7641507 7524419476
652216477 237 7908
See more
79 09470315385 84592284907
3392 35196258917 884968 28
See more